A jump starter is one of those products you hope you do not need, but you are very glad to have when a battery will not start the vehicle. It is emergency backup, not a complete battery-care plan. After using a jump starter, you should still test and charge the battery to understand why it went flat.

A good jump starter belongs with a battery tester and charger. The jump starter gets you moving. The tester and charger help prevent the same problem from happening again.
